Geranium wilfordii is a traditional Chinese medicine with various effects such as clearing heat and detoxifying, promoting blood circulation to remove blood stasis, resolving phlegm and relieving cough, strengthening the spleen and stimulating appetite, and astringing to stop bleeding. These effects make Geranium wilfordii somewhat effective in treating conditions such as headache, febrile diseases, rash, dysentery, abdominal pain in children, eczema, whooping cough, and uremia. However, for sinusitis specifically, Geranium wilfordii is not considered a primary treatment medication.

Geranium wilfordii has certain anti-inflammatory and detoxifying effects. For acute sinusitis caused by bacterial infection, it may help alleviate inflammation and reduce symptoms such as nasal congestion and headache. According to traditional Chinese medicine theory, Geranium wilfordii is often used in combination with other herbs to enhance therapeutic effects. Therefore, under the guidance of a qualified TCM practitioner, Geranium wilfordii may be used as an adjunctive method for sinusitis and may provide some improvement.

In daily life, patients are advised to maintain good lifestyle habits, such as avoiding allergens, keeping indoor air fresh, and regularly cleaning the nasal cavity.
